Title: Materials Data on PmRh3 by Materials Project

PmRh3 is Uranium Silicide structured and crystallizes in the cubic Pm-3m space group. The structure is three-dimensional. Pm is bonded to twelve equivalent Rh atoms to form a mixture of face and corner-sharing PmRh12 cuboctahedra. All Pm–Rh bond lengths are 2.91 Å. Rh is bonded in a distorted square co-planar geometry to four equivalent Pm atoms.
